Ten Tips To Make Your Car Last Longer
Getting from point A to point B by car costs a certain amount of dough, and thanks to the U.S. economy it takes more of your hard-earned money than ever before. But while you can’t always control ownership costs such as fuel, repairs and insurance rates, one thing you do have power over is making your car last longer and maintaining its value. Here you have a choice: Either spend money on a new car every few years or keep your current car running great and looking sharp. If you decide to go the latter route, follow these 10 tips to help keep your ride rolling.
Breathe Easier
Even the most mechanically challenged drivers know to change a car’s oil and oil filter on a regular basis ” even if they don’t always do it. But other fluids and filters also need regular maintenance. For example, changing your air filter helps your car breathe easier and the engine last longer. “If your air filter is clogged, your engine is not performing properly,” notes Jack Nerad, editorial director and executive market analyst for Kelley Blue Book. “It also hurts your fuel economy, and it can harm the engine over the long term.”
Keep It Cool
Maintaining your car’s cooling system and the proper coolant level is as important as making sure the engine is well lubed and can potentially save you thousands of dollars in repairs. “A cooling system failure can result in your engine literally melting down,” warns Nerad. “Because of lack of proper coolant and maintenance of hoses, you can have major problems.”
Pressure Check
Tires are often the most neglected part of a car, Nerad adds. “Most people don’t pay much attention to keeping their tires at the right inflation pressure,” he says. “And it’s not only bad for the car, the tires and fuel economy, but it’s also a safety issue. The simple step of keeping the tires up to proper pressure is valuable all the way around,” he adds, “and it essentially costs almost nothing.”
Fully En-Gauged
If there is a problem with your oil pressure, cooling system or even tire pressure on the latest vehicles, your car’s gauges will tell you ” if you’re paying attention to them. “The vast majority of people don’t,” remarks Nerad. “That’s why manufacturers went to ‘idiot lights’ to give a clear indication of when there’s a problem.”
Get Regular Checkups
Find a repair shop and mechanic you trust. “And let that shop service your car all the time,” says Dave Jones, owner of Jones Automotive in Green County, Pennsylvania, and co-host of the Web site AskAutoPro.com. “When you get sick you don’t go to a different doctor every time. Your doctor knows you from top to bottom, inside and out.” A good mechanic will get to know your car and look over it the same way, Jones adds.
Look Closely
Jones also suggests spending time inspecting your car. “Every now and then, take five minutes and walk around the car and look at it,” he said. Check to see if the tires are wearing unevenly. Open the hood and check out the hoses. Make sure all the lights are working. “It only takes a couple of minutes to check things like that,” he adds.
Get on a Schedule
While your owner’s manual will have a maintenance schedule, another advantage of using the same mechanics on a regular basis is they will be able to make sure you stick to the schedule ” and take care of things the manual may not include. “If you go to different places each time you have your car serviced, they won’t know the last time you had something done,” says Aaron Clements, owner of C&C Automotive in Augusta, Georgia, and a 31-year auto-repair veteran. “So you may end up paying for unnecessary repairs. Most shops have electronic records so they know when each service was done. The scheduled maintenance charts in owner’s manuals tell only part of the story,” he adds. “So it’s also a benefit to have a relationship with a service advisor who knows your vehicle and when to perform service in addition to what’s in the owner’s manual.”
Drive Smarter
The way you drive has an effect on how long your car ” and your gas ” will last. “You not only save wear and tear by having good driving habits, but also fuel,” claims Clements. “Taking off fast and coming to a stop quickly can be bad on a car and affect the engine, the brakes and other things.”
Keep It Clean
Nerad also stresses taking care of the exterior of your car by regularly washing and waxing it. And don’t forget about the interior. “That’s an often overlooked area,” he says. “Spend time keeping it clean and clean-smelling without perfuming it, and vacuum the carpet on a regular basis. Get spills out immediately because if you don’t they’re more difficult to remove.”
Keep it Covered
Nerad also suggests storing your car in a garage or under a carport or cover. “Keep your car out of the sun,” he says. “And keep it away from bird droppings and tree sap. Also be careful where you park to avoid dings,” he adds.
Keeping your car maintained will not only make it last longer but also will make it much more pleasant to drive ” which will make you want to take better care of it. “If you have a vehicle that looks good and you enjoy getting in it and driving, you’re much more prone to take care of it,” observes Clements.” And since it won’t last forever, taking care of your car will also increase the resale value. “It’s very clear on our site that condition is crucial,” says Nerad. “In real estate they say it’s all about location, location, location, but with car values it’s all about condition, condition, condition.”

5 Useful Ideas to Grab the Lowest Rental Car Cost
Leasing a car can be a very convenient way to get around the city; however, they can also cost you a pretty amount of cash. Thankfully, there are specific methods which can help you get inexpensive rates and cut costs.
Determine the proper vehicle
The very first thing you need to do is determine what kind of automobile you’ll get based on your personal wants and the requirements of the passengers who will be traveling with you. If you are the only person who will be in the vehicle, then it is smart to rent a small vehicle, which will be less expensive than a bigger one. Choose the car size which is suitable for the quantity of passengers you will have with you in the vehicle.
Search for a car online
Most car rental promotions and also discounts are offered only through their own sites. Therefore, it is best to look for a car hire through the internet, and it’ll also save you effort and time. View numerous websites that offer car services in the particular region where you’ll need the car. Assess their rates for the certain automobile which you like, as well as the promotions. Then evaluate their rates and choose the ideal one.
Book ahead of time
Just like many other things, booking a vehicle well advance can help you save money. Not only might you be provided a cheap car hire promotion for early reservation, but you will also be more likely to find the affordable car brand name that you have in your mind and that will best suit your budget and requirements. Booking beforehand will also keep you from being influenced to rental car agencies near the airport terminal, where the highest car hire charges are found. These sites naturally have higher leasing fees and benefit from clients who’re in a hurry to have their own car. But if you already reserved your own car, then you could go directly to the venue of the leasing corporation you booked with and not worry about still having to find a vehicle or paying a much higher fee.
Evaluate additional fees
Car rental companies normally include more fees on top of your rental price to cover potential theft and damage fees. Prior to signing any paper, check with your insurance broker whether your own car insurance has a car rental rider covering theft and damage so you do not have to unnecessarily pay for these at the hire car corporation. Moreover, many rental car companies charge extra fees for shipment and pick up; you’ll have to do these tasks yourself to avoid paying for these services. When returning the vehicle, be sure to refuel it with similar amount of fuel it had when you picked it up. This is because you’ll be billed an exorbitant cost for every gallon of petrol that is required to fill the car’s gas tank again.
Check out the automobile before taking it out
Before you get in the car and leave the premises of the hire car company, give it a thorough review for any dents and let a staff member know about anything you may find. This is to keep you safe from being charged with causing dents or scratches that may have already been there.
Always bring a copy of the list of additional fees and expenses a car rental company might charge you so you can more easily try to avoid these.

Car Maintenance Tips to Take You from Winter to Spring
Wisconsin winters are tough. Whilst most people take the time to prepare their vehicle for the harsh winter months ahead, few consider the importance of making preparations for spring. The moment the temperature gauge starts to creep up, you should think about booking a visit with your local car repair shop to give your trusty vehicle a little TLC.
Following a regular car maintenance schedule through the seasons will ensure your vehicle is ready to face the conditions ahead whether youll be negotiating icy roads or driving in humid or arid conditions.
Car repair shops offer a comprehensive range of seasonal checks that will prepare your car, truck or any other vehicle you drive for the months of driving ahead. Truck maintenance is especially vital as these vehicles must be fit for purpose and transport their load safely.
Car Maintenance Schedule for the Spring and Summer
Springtime is a time of reawakening and renewal following the cold winter months. Attending to the maintenance guidelines below will ensure your vehicle emerges from the winter in roadworthy condition. A well maintained vehicle will give you years more reliable service and be less prone to major faults.
Swap out tiresIf youve been using winter tires, its time to swap these out for all-season tires. Check each tire is inflated and balanced and also ensure you have a well-maintained spare tire available. Any car repair shop should be able to help you with checking your tire pressure and ensuring your tire tread is sufficient and most importantly, legal.
Check your brakesIcy roads mean heavy braking and that can put your brake pads under a lot of pressure. If youve noticed brake squeal or any grinding noises when hitting the brakes, you need to get them checked as soon as possible.
Top up your fluidsA well-lubricated vehicle is a happy vehicle. So many engine parts rely on liquids to keep them cool, oiled and working at optimum levels. Again, booking a seasonal check at your local car repair shop will identify any problems with fluid levels. Engine oil, coolant, transmission fluid, and windscreen washer fluid are all essential to the performance of your vehicle and levels need to be checked and topped up at regular intervals. Over the winter, freezing temperatures can cause these fluids to become dull and ineffective so a complete drain out and top up with fresh fluids is recommended.
Automatic transmissionvehicles with automatic transmissions need special consideration when refreshing fluids. Overheating is a real problem with these vehicles and its therefore important to keep vehicle fluids at the right level.
Air-conditioning and ventilationYou probably havent had your air-conditioning on during the winter months so its a good idea to have a complete service of the system to ensure it works perfectly on those hot days.
General component checkslights, seatbelts, dashboard warning lights, wiper blades, spark plugs and hoses should be checked for general wear and tear and replaced or repaired if faults are found.

Car Insurance Advice UK
Whether you’re a new driver or a seasoned veteran, finding cheap car insurance can often prove difficult. In recent times, car insurance premiums have rocketed and you may be quite surprised when it comes renewing that you have to fork out even more than before! So how can I get cheap car insurance, I hear you plead?
Insurance Groups
Well, if you are first time driver, forget the two seater sports car. The best way to get cheap car insurance is to choose a car that is in a low insurance group – this will reduce your premiums dramatically. It?s also a good idea to avoid the twin exhausts, tinted windows and optional alloy wheels as all these ‘extras’ will bump up your motor insurance.
Get Specialist Insurance
If you already own a car then your next plan should be to shop around. A good tip is to look for car insurance companies that cater for your personal circumstance. Did you know that female drivers can get cheaper car insurance by getting insured with ‘women only’ insurers? These companies reward you with reduced premiums and often throw in extras like free handbag insurance.
If you are a young driver or new driver, desperately hunting for affordable car insurance, then consider getting quotes from specialist firms who cater for the younger market. They have experience insuring drivers with little experience and can often offer great, competitive quotes.
Penalty Points
What about if I have penalty points or motoring offences? Fear not! Despite what you may have heard, you can still find cheap insurance even if you have points on your license. There are a huge number of car insurance companies who cater for drivers who have been disqualified or have points. It is worth shopping around and getting a list of quotes from specialist brokers as premiums can vary dramatically.
Always Shop Around!
Regardless of your gender, situation or age, it is an excellent idea to shop around before you part with your hard earned cash. Don’t accept the first car insurance quote given to you – prices vary and the more you shop around the better the deal you’re going to find.
The Basics of Car Insurance
If you’re new to car insurance it can seem like a complicated subject, but once you get past all the hype and marketing of the insurance companies, it’s really quite simple. Motor insurance comes in three basic forms, which will be your starting point when deciding which policy to take out.
Third Party
This is the simplest, cheapest form of insurance you can buy, and it’s also required by law for every vehicle on the road. Basically, a policy of this kind means that if you cause an accident, then any damage caused to someone else’s vehicle will be paid for and they won’t be left out of pocket.
With third party insurance, damage to your own car will not be covered, nor will you be able to claim if your vehicle is stolen.
Third Party, Fire And Theft
This kind of policy is one step up from simple third party. As well as covering damage you cause to another vehicle, your own car is covered against theft or damage caused by fire. This insurance isn’t much more expensive than the most basic kind, and so most people choose it in preference as it gives better cover for little extra cost.
Comprehensive Insurance
Comprehensive car insurance is quite a bit more expensive than third party, as it will also cover any damage to your own car in an accident that was your own fault. You’ll also be covered for damage caused by someone else if that person’s insurance can’t be claimed on – for example, in a ‘hit and run’ accident.
Many comprehensive policies go even further, covering your in-car audio systems for example, or providing free windscreen replacement, roadside assistance, and even accomodation and transport if your car is put out of action. Naturally, these features will tend to bump up the price, so only include them on your policy if they’re likely to be of use to you.
What’s Commonly Included in a Fully Comprehensive Car Insurance Policy
If you wish to be covered for almost every eventuality then fully comprehensive insurance is the way to go. This type of car insurance means that you are covered for damage, not only to another person’s car but your own too.
Full Insurance Protection
Comprehensive insurance provides peace of mind that if you were to cause an accident you wouldn’t lose out financially (apart from the excess). Generally speaking, fully comprehensive car insurance also comes with legal protection and injury cover which means that you will also be protected if you were to cause injury to yourself or another person.
Many of the optional extras you can choose to include in third party insurance comes as standard with a comprehensive policy. Most insurers will offer windscreen cover as standard, they will also include a courtesy car. This is a great benefit, especially if you need access to a car for work.
Replacement Car
Similarly, if your car were to be written off, then the insurer should replace the car or offer money to the same value as the car. This is an excellent benefit, especially if you drive an expensive car and simply wouldn’t be able to afford it if the worst was to happen.
Cover Levels
What may vary slightly from one insurer to the next is the level of cover. Some may only offer 1,000 personal injury cover whereas others could go up as high as 10,000+. With this in mind, it’s important that you read the small print and learn what and what isn’t included within the policy. Some comprehensive polices won’t include in-car audio or cover for any additional equipment you may have added. Similarly, if you have made modifications to your car then this could void your policy which is why it’s a good idea to call your insurer first to check what you will be covered for.

Details of Car Shipping to Durban
The RORO method is said to be the most inexpensive method that you can avail of if you have plans of shipping to South Africa generally large items like cars. This is because charges are applied only on the space taken up by the car once this is loaded onto a RORO vessel. The method also happens to be quite secure since your vehicle gets checked several times while this is being shipped.
Additionally, extreme care is taken to ensure that your vehicle is not unnecessarily damaged from the moment this gets loaded until the RORO ship reaches its destination. Travel time of the ship lasts from as short as 20 days to as long as 30. For its trip to Durban in South Africa, the vessel departs from its base in the UK once every 14 days.
The second method of vehicle shipping to Durban involves the use of containers. Under a container shipping to Durban method, your vehicle gets placed inside containers having either a 20 or 40 feet measurement. Ratchet straps and chocks are primarily used to secure the vehicle while inside these containers.
The difference between a 20-foot container and a 4-foot one is that with the latter, you can load anywhere from 2 to 3 different vehicles, However, this will still depend on the size of the vehicles involved. Regardless of the container size used, the ship carrying them travels from 24 to 31 days before reaching the port in Durban.
Inside these containers, the vehicle is usually considered hazardous goods. As such, car shipping to Durban will involve being supplied with the so-called Dangerous Goods Note which serves as a form of added protection for your car. People will naturally have second thoughts about toying with containers tagged as having dangerous items inside. The same thing can be said when it comes to shipping a truck to Durban.
On the other hand, in Cape Town, the process of car shipping is seen as a lot longer and normally more expensive. This is mainly because this particular town in South Africa is known for having a highly-rated mass transport system. As such, there is no need to ship your car over unless you have plans of doing a lot of travels while staying in South Africa. Even so, many visitors are known to simply sell their vehicles before coming over to the country where they eventually purchase a less expensive car which they can use for their various trips.
Upon arrival in Durban port, the next step in your car shipping to Durban process is to have your vehicle cleared by South African customs authorities. After this, the cleared vehicle has to be loaded onto an automobile carrier which will take the same to its destination. In this regard, it is important to note that if your vehicle has been brought to Durban in transit prior to being taken to such countries as Botswana, Malawi, Lesotho, Swaziland, Zambia, and Zimbabwe, this will not be given the license to be taken across South Africa.

Good Maintenance Of Car Can Save Hundreds Of Dollars!
When shopping for a new car, you might be able to save hundreds of dollars by comparison shopping and finding the best price. But good maintenance and driving practices can save you thousands if it means you won’t have to buy another car for twenty years.
Another good reason is that because we feel the effects of winter more harshly than summer, we go to extra lengths to protect ourselves with coats and hats and gloves. Most of us make sure that our cars are ready for the onslaught of frigid winter weather too. We make sure we have snow tires, an ice scraper and deicer.
However, in summer months we can shed our heavy and restrictive coats and hats and take life easy. We also tend to be more lax with our car care too. Remember, you car needs protection and routine maintenance year round, no matter what the temperature.
Your engine is affected by extremes of temperature. Don’t think that it isn’t hard on the engine when you sit idling in a traffic jam in 90 degree plus temperature with the air conditioner blasting away inside.
The first reason to keep up a maintenance schedule is to save you money in the long run. If you have a newer car in order to keep the warranty in effect you need to have it serviced according to your manufacturers recommended schedule.
If your car is older and out of warranty you need to be more vigilant. It’s up to you to make a service schedule for your car. Make a checklist and keep track of the following items;
Oil. This should be changed every 3,000 miles. If you car is “using” oil as the saying goes, check it every other time you fill up. Carry an extra quart of oil in the trunk. Along with an oil change most “speedy” oil change business check belts, hoses, fluid levels, tires, etc.
Antifreeze. Have your cars heating and cooling system checked on at least yearly. You want to make sure you have adequate temperature protection, summer and winter.
Air cleaner. This should be checked at the same time you have your oil changed. A clogged air cleaner can really slow down your engines performance.
Brakes. If you notice any squealing of your breaks have them checked as soon as possible. It’s much cheaper to replace worn pads than it is to have to replace expensive rotors if they become worn.
Tires. The air pressure is usually checked at the same time you have your oil changed. You should also have the tires rotated on a regular basis; this can really prolong their life.
Battery. Batteries are sealed units now. Have the battery checked at least once a year.
